#60e281 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#60e281 is composed of 37.6% red, 88.6% green and 50.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 42.9%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 135.2 degrees, a saturation of 69.1% and a lightness of 63.1%. #60e281 color hex could be obtained by blending #c0ffff with #00c503.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

#60e281 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#60e281 has RGB values of R:96, G:226, B:129 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0, Y:0.43,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 6349441.
